Ah, end-of-semester in Forest Grove: The temperatures rise, the sun emerges from hiding, and a…read morecertain class of local customer vents its spleen about reasonable levels of service that they've taken as personal slights and affronts to their character. Corona, unfortunately, is a magnet for this type of individual. A counter-service taqueria that prides itself on a robust menu (including a college-town eating contest involving a burrito roughly the size of an anaconda), party cocktails (snake-green margarita with energy drink, anyone?), and a festive atmosphere of live music, theme parties, comedy, and karaoke. It's a place that's typically a beloved college-town staple, but has its rating knocked down a few pegs around this time of year by disgruntled customers looking to settle scores. Armed with petty resentments stemming from an occasion when the restaurant confiscated their fake ID, cut off alcohol service to them and their pre-gamed and over served friends, or booted them out of the place for being their worst selves, these folks will navigate a platform's rules to insist that--suddenly and swiftly--the quality of its food/drinks/service has gone into the toilet. Well, despite what the end-of-semester tide of vitriol indicates, Corona is every bit what it once was... even if that fairly low bar was near-campus party restaurant. The food is neither the best nor worst in this corner of Washington County (amid strong competition), the drinks tend toward goofy hummingbird feed but are still as inexpensive and potent as campus adjacency would suggest, and the service holds up remarkably well for a staff that's regularly dealing with clientele that's still approaching the world in its service-industry training wheels. A rural college town can be a difficult setting for any restaurant. You're asked to cater to more cosmopolitan diets that the surrounding area typically addresses and, at the same time, are asked to please a clientele that chooses its entrees based on photographs of food included with the menu. If there's a middle ground, it seldom shows up in reviews. But Corona has weathered far worse than seasonal agitation--it was nearly destroyed by an arsonist in 2023--and continues to provide a more consistent menu and community space than the end-of-semester screeds suggest. It's difficult to please everyone in this kind of college town, but Tacqueria Corona has become exactly the resilient staple Forest Grove and Pacific students (and faculty) deserve.
